Thesis sheet of Heinrich Philipp von Beeck (h) on the occasion of his disputation at the University of Bamberg about Ferdinand IV’s coronation of the Roman-German king in 1653

Caption: [M.] "FERDINANDO IV CORONATO | ROMANORUM REGI. [...] “(The Crowned Roman King Ferdinand IV) (dedication cartouche at the center of the depiction); [u]” Quarum Conclusionum Veritatem in Bambergensi Academia propugnabit Illustris Dominus D. Henricus Philippus Liber Baro De Beeck. | Praeside Reverendo Patre Antonio Winthero è Societate JESU AA. LL. et Philosophiae Magistro, Ejusdemq (ue) Professore Ordinario."
